Frequently Asked Questions about Utilities Included Anaheim Apartments

What is the Cheapest Utilities Included apartment in Anaheim?

Currently the most affordable Utilities Included Apartment in Anaheim is at Pradera Apartment Homes listed at $1,142.

How much is the average rent for a Utilities Included Anaheim Apartment?

The average rent for a Utilities Included Apartment in Anaheim is $2,286.

What is the largest Utilities Included Anaheim Apartment for rent?

Today's Utilities Included apartment with the most square footage in Anaheim is a 1,581 square feet unit starting from $2,613 at Avel Apartment Homes.

What is the average size for Anaheim Utilities Included Apartments for rent?

The average size for a Utilities Included rental in Anaheim is currently at 726 sq ft.
